Small Bowl

Maker Chupícuaro culture, Mexico, Guanajuanto
Date300-100 BC
Made/manufacturedNorth and Central America
MediumCeramic with pigment
Dimensionsheight x diameter: 1 5/8 x 5 3/8 in. (4.1 x 13.7 cm)
ClassificationsCeramics
Credit LineGift of Irvin Ebaugh
Object numberC-74-43
On View
Not on view
Collections
DescriptionSmall shallow bowl with rounded base and even flaring wall, no lip. Buff ware with red slip painted in a band around the rim, inside and out. Circle of red slip on inside of bowl at bottom.
